Text

633.01 In this chapter: 633.01(1) (1) “Administrator” means a person who directly or indirectly solicits or collects premiums or charges or otherwise effects coverage or adjusts or settles claims for an employee benefit plan, but does not include the following persons if they perform these acts under the circumstances specified for each: 633.01(1)(a) (a) An employer on behalf of its employees or the employees of a subsidiary or affiliated employer. 633.01(1)(b) (b) A union on behalf of its members. 633.01(1)(c) (c) A creditor on behalf of its debtor, if to obtain payment, reimbursement or other method of satisfaction from an employee benefit plan for any part of a debt owed to the creditor by the debtor. 633.01(1)(d) (d) A financial institution that is subject to supervision or regulation
